Percutaneous Radiofrequency Neurotomy for Treatment of Chronic Pain from the Upper Cervical (C2-3) Spine

Please note: All assessments are current as of the review date; however, new evidence that may have been published subsequently is not considered.
Review Date: June 20, 2007
Recommendation: This topic was reviewed by the California Technology Assessment Forum on June 20, 2007. It was recommended that the use of Percutaneous Radiofrequency Neurotomy does not meet TA criteria 2 through 5 for safety, effectiveness and improvement in health outcomes for the treatment of chronic upper cervical (C2-3) neck pain or headache.
Decision: Does Not Meet CTAF Criteria
